DSM-IV mania symptoms in a prepubertal and early adolescent bipolar disorder phenotype compared to attention-deficit hyperactive and normal controls.
Journal of child and adolescent psychopharmacology - 1 Jan 2002
Geller Barbara, Zimerman Betsy, Williams Marlene, Delbello Melissa P, Bolhofner Kristine, Craney James L, Frazier Jeanne, Beringer Linda, Nickelsburg Michael J
Abstract excerpt
OBJECTIVE: To compare the prevalence of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, 4th edition (DSM-IV) mania symptoms in a prepubertal and early adolescent bipolar disorder phenotype (PEA-BP) to those with att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and normal community controls...
